I agree with some of what your saying. Most wildland firefighters would say if it's not going to threaten any lives or structures, let it burn. The general public is ignorant about the fact that fire is a natural part of the ecosystem. When the public starts screaming about a fire showing up, our politicians start streaming about putting the fire out. Since around 1910, when "The Big Burn" happened, our leaders decided that "fire bad, put it out". Notice I didn't say support our "masters". I said support our firefighters.

Here's a good example of public perception of fire. We started putting together crews to manage fires instead of putting them out. We called them Fire Use Modules. The public was outraged by the thought that we wouldn't put out a fire if we had the chance.
